DIESEL ENGINE LUBRICATED WITH FUEL SUCH AS DIESEL OIL
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a diesel engine lubricated with fuel such as diesel oil, capable of avoiding supply of fuel after being highly contaminated to an injection system to the utmost, and satisfying demand for lubricant that is different in respective engine parts.
